East Watertown, Watertown, MA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en East Watertown?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en East Watertown | $2,712 | $1,850 | $5,686 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en East Watertown | $3,331 | $2,200 | $7,308 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en East Watertown | $3,715 | $2,200 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en East Watertown | $3,835 | $2,800 | $6,100 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en East Watertown | $4,852 | $3,200 | $6,600 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en East Watertown?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$3,243 | $2,200 | $4,295 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$3,553 | $2,500 | $5,400 |
| Casas con 4 Dormitorios | $4,463 | $3,400 | $5,950 |
| Casas con 5 Dormitorios | $4,950 | $4,200 | $5,450 |
| Casas con 6 Dormitorios | $7,175 | $6,250 | $9,950 |
